Step 2: Enter Your Minimal Mockup Brief
Write a concise prompt that names the subject, white or neutral background, alignment, spacing, and accent color. Example: “Phone case on off‑white, centered, soft shadow, thin headline above, small brand mark bottom‑right.” In CapCut, you can also choose aspect ratios (1:1, 4:5, 16:9) and a style preset that reinforces clarity. Use Advanced settings to increase prompt adherence and style scale when you want the AI to strictly follow your layout intent.
Step 3: Let AI Generate Mockup Concepts
Click Generate to produce multiple clean options. Evaluate each concept for hierarchy (primary object is dominant), breathing room (ample margins), and balance (headline, visual, and small caption in harmony). Select the strongest candidate and duplicate it for variations—change background tone slightly, adjust margins, or swap accent color to build a cohesive set without clutter.
Step 4: Refine The Layout On The Canvas
Use the editor to tighten alignment, tweak contrast, and remove distractions. Keep typography minimal—one sans-serif family, clear sizes for headline and caption, and consistent line spacing. If the subject needs isolation, apply background removal, then reintroduce a soft shadow for depth. Aim for readable spacing: generous padding around edges, consistent gutters, and a single focal point.

What Prompts Work Best For Minimal Mockup Design?
Use short, specific language: subject, backdrop color or material, alignment, spacing, accent tone, and shadow style. Example: “Center a ceramic mug on warm gray, soft shadow, headline top‑left, brand icon bottom‑right.” Avoid overly decorative instructions; keep the focus on hierarchy and balance.
